> > I've compiled RH 2.4.7-10 and kernel.org 2.4.7 using identical
> > configurations.  Timestamps have 1us resolution in the fresh
> > copy of 2.4.7 and 10ms resolution in RH 2.4.7-10.
> > 
> > RedHat definitely did something to the kernel that broke the
> > do_gettimeofday functionality.  They've futzed with
> > arch/i386/kernel/time.c in ways that look suspect.
> 
> You should report that to Red Hat as a bug.

After wandering around RedHat's Bugzilla server for a while, I
think bug number 61111 (dated 9 days ago) is describing this
issue.  The bug is logged agains tcpdump, though I'm pretty
sure it's a kernel issue.

I've added a comment to that bug...
